Which encapsulation type forms a protective membrane over ACM?

Explanation:
When dealing with asbestos-containing materials, encapsulation methods aim to prevent fiber release by creating a barrier. Bridging encapsulation is the one that forms a protective membrane over the surface of ACM. It applies a coating that dries into a continuous film across the material, spanning cracks and surface imperfections to seal fibers at the exterior. This creates a physical skin or membrane that blocks fibers from becoming airborne, which is especially important on damaged or friable ACM. Penetrating encapsulation works by penetrating into the material to bind fibers from within, but it doesn’t create that surface membrane. A coating encapsulation also forms a surface film, but it doesn’t specifically address bridging gaps or cracks like bridging encapsulation does. For forming a protective membrane over ACM, bridging is the best-fit description.
